How often and how long should a deload be for?

BigButtons · 28/01/2024 17:58

IrisBearded · 28/01/2024 17:54

@bigbuttons sorry you're suffering with injuries. It must feel frustrating when you're used to being active. I hope the rest helps.

How often and how long should a deload be for?

Thanks. I have left it too long - as usual and ignored the signs.
we are all different and there is no formula. Everyone does it differently. I know I need to when I start feel super tired and lethargic and find any exercise difficult.
some people do light weights, some yoga, some nothing at all. Some deload with regularly- say every 4-6 weeks and others just play it by ear.

samthebordercollie · 01/02/2024 11:11

@ellebelli form is more important than weight. Go lighter or even no weights for squats and lunges until you get the correct form. I know when I wobble around the weights I'm using are too heavy!
